Конвертация Excel в картинку: от скриншота до профессионального экспорта

Нужно сохранить таблицу Microsoft Excel в виде изображения, но обычный скриншот даёт размытый результат? Или требуется экспортировать диаграмму в высоком разрешении для презентации? Конвертация Excel в картинку — задача, с которой сталкиваются аналитики, маркетологи и студенты. В этой статье разберём все рабочие способы: от стандартных функций программы до специализированных онлайн-сервисов и плагинов.

Важно понимать, что простое копирование таблицы через Ctrl+CCtrl+V в графический редактор часто приводит к искажению шрифтов, обрезке ячеек или потере форматирования. Мы покажем, как избежать этих проблем и получить картинку с разрешением до 300 dpi, пригодную для печати в журналах или использования в веб-дизайне. Все методы протестированы на версиях Excel 2016–2023 и Microsoft 365.

1. Стандартный экспорт через "Копировать как картинку" в Excel

Самый быстрый способ — использовать встроенную функцию "Копировать как картинку". Она доступна во всех версиях Excel и сохраняет исходное форматирование таблицы. Подходит для экспорта отдельных диапазонов или целых листов.

Как это работает:

  • 📋 Выделите нужный диапазон ячеек (или нажмите Ctrl+A, чтобы выбрать весь лист).
  • 🖼️ Перейдите на вкладку Главная → группа Буфер обмена → кликните по стрелочке под кнопкой Копировать → выберите Копировать как картинку.
  • 🎨 В открывшемся окне выберите:

    - "Как на экране" — для точного отображения текущего вида;

    - "Как при печати" — если нужно сохранить разметку страницы.

  • 🖥️ Вставьте картинку в любой редактор (Paint, Photoshop, Word) через Ctrl+V и сохраните в нужном формате (.png, .jpg).
⚠️ Внимание: При копировании больших таблиц (свыше 50×50 ячеек) Excel может автоматически уменьшить масштаб картинки. Чтобы этого избежать, предварительно установите масштаб отображения листа на 100% через ползунок в правом нижнем углу окна.

Установить масштаб 100%|Убрать лишние строки/столбцы|Проверить видимость всех данных|Отключить обрезку текста в ячейках-->

Преимущества метода:

  • ⚡ Мгновенный результат без установки дополнительного ПО.
  • 🔄 Сохраняются все стили (цвета, шрифты, границы).
  • 📊 Подходит для диаграмм и сводных таблиц.

Недостатки:

  • 🔍 Низкое разрешение при увеличении (максимум 96 dpi).
  • 📏 Неудобно для экспорта нескольких листов одновременно.

2. Сохранение в PDF с последующей конвертацией в изображение

Если требуется высокое качество (например, для полиграфии), оптимальный путь — экспорт в .pdf с последующим преобразованием в картинку. Этот метод даёт разрешение до 300 dpi и сохраняет векторные элементы (диаграммы, фигурный текст).

Пошаговая инструкция:

  1. Откройте файл в Excel и перейдите в Файл → Экспорт → Создать PDF/XPS.
  2. В окне сохранения выберите PDF и нажмите Опубликовать.
  3. Откройте полученный PDF в Adobe Acrobat или Foxit Reader.
  4. Используйте функцию Экспорт в изображениеAcrobat: Файл → Экспорт в → Изображение → PNG/JPEG).
  5. Задайте разрешение 300 dpi и выберите страницы для экспорта.
Параметр Значение для печати Значение для веб
Разрешение 300 dpi 72–96 dpi
Формат PNG (прозрачность) JPEG (меньший вес)
Цветовая модель CMYK RGB
Сжатие Без потерь Среднее (80–90%)
⚠️ Внимание: При экспорте диаграмм из PDF в JPEG возможны артефакты на тонких линиях. Для таких случаев лучше использовать формат PNG-24 или векторный SVG (если поддерживается целевой сервис).

PNG|JPEG|PDF|SVG|Другой-->

3. Онлайн-сервисы для конвертации Excel в картинку

Если нет возможности использовать Excel или Adobe Acrobat, на помощь придут онлайн-конвертеры. Они удобны для разовых задач и не требуют установки ПО. Однако важно выбрать надёжный сервис, чтобы избежать утечки конфиденциальных данных.

Топ-3 проверенных инструмента:

  • 🌐 Zamzar (www.zamzar.com) — поддерживает .xlsx, .xls, экспорт в JPG/PNG/TIFF. Бесплатно до 5 файлов в день.
  • 📊 CloudConvert (cloudconvert.com) — позволяет настроить разрешение и качество. Есть API для автоматизации.
  • 🔄 Convertio (convertio.co) — простой интерфейс, но ограничение по размеру файла (100 МБ).

Как пользоваться (на примере CloudConvert):

  1. Загрузите файл .xlsx на сайт (перетаскиванием или через кнопку Выбрать файлы).
  2. Выберите целевой формат (PNG или JPEG).
  3. В разделе Настройки укажите:

    - Разрешение: 300 dpi;

    - Качество: 100%;

    - Цветовой профиль: sRGB.

  4. Нажмите Конвертировать и скачайте результат.
Безопасность онлайн-конвертеров

Все перечисленные сервисы удаляют загруженные файлы с серверов в течение 24 часов, но для работы с конфиденциальными данными (финансовые отчёты, персональная информация) рекомендуется использовать офлайн-методы или плагины с локальной обработкой.

Плюсы онлайн-сервисов:

  • 🚀 Нет нужды в установке программ.
  • 🔧 Поддержка редких форматов (например, TIFF для полиграфии).
  • 📱 Работают на любых устройствах (включая смартфоны).

Минусы:

  • 🔒 Риск утечки данных (особенно для корпоративных файлов).
  • ⏳ Ограничения по размеру файла и количеству конвертаций.
  • 📶 Требуется стабильное интернет-соединение.

4. Использование плагинов для Excel (Kutools, Ablebits)

Для пользователей, регулярно экспортирующих таблицы в изображения, удобнее установить специализированные надстройки. Они расширяют функционал Excel и позволяют автоматизировать процесс.

Два самых популярных плагина:

  • 🛠️ Kutools for Excel — включает инструмент Export Range to File, который сохраняет выделенный диапазон в PNG/JPEG/PDF с настройками качества. Стоимость: от $39 за лицензию.
  • 📈 Ablebits — пакет утилит с функцией Save as Picture. Поддерживает пакетную обработку нескольких листов. Бесплатная пробная версия на 14 дней.

Инструкция для Kutools:

  1. Установите плагин и перезапустите Excel.
  2. Выделите диапазон и перейдите на вкладку Kutools PlusImport/ExportExport Range to File.
  3. В окне настроек выберите:

    - Формат: PNG;

    - Разрешение: High (300 dpi);

    - Опцию Include headers (если нужны заголовки).

  4. Укажите папку для сохранения и нажмите OK.

Когда стоит выбрать плагины:

  • 📅 Ежедневная конвертация десятков таблиц.
  • 🔄 Нужна пакетная обработка нескольких файлов.
  • 🎨 Требуются расширенные настройки (обрезка, добавление водяных знаков).

5. Автоматизация через VBA-скрипты

Для продвинутых пользователей, которым нужно интегрировать экспорт в рабочий процесс, подойдёт VBA-макрос. Он позволяет сохранять таблицы в изображения с заданными параметрами по одному клику.

Пример скрипта для экспорта активного листа в PNG:

Sub ExportSheetAsImage()

Dim ws As Worksheet

Dim chartObj As ChartObject

Dim tempChart As Chart

Dim exportPath As String

' Указываем путь для сохранения

exportPath = "C:\Temp\ExcelExport.png"

' Создаём временную диаграмму для экспорта

Set ws = ActiveSheet

Set chartObj = ws.ChartObjects.Add(0, 0, ws.UsedRange.Width, ws.UsedRange.Height)

Set tempChart = chartObj.Chart

' Копируем данные как картинку

ws.UsedRange.CopyPicture Appearance:=xlScreen, Format:=xlPicture

' Экспортируем

tempChart.Paste

tempChart.Export exportPath, "PNG"

' Удаляем временную диаграмму

chartObj.Delete

MsgBox "Лист сохранён как " & exportPath, vbInformation

End Sub

Как использовать:

  1. Нажмите Alt+F11, чтобы открыть редактор VBA.
  2. Вставьте код в новый модуль (Insert → Module).
  3. Запустите макрос через F5 или назначьте его на кнопку на панели Excel.

Преимущества VBA:

  • ⚡ Мгновенный экспорт без ручных действий.
  • 🔧 Гибкая настройка (можно добавить сжатие, переименование файлов).
  • 📂 Интеграция с другими макросами (например, предварительная обработка данных).

Недостатки:

  • 💻 Требует навыков программирования для модификации кода.
  • 🔒 Макросы могут блокироваться политиками безопасности компании.

6. Экспорт диаграмм и графиков в высоком качестве

Диаграммы и графики в Excel часто требуют отдельной обработки, так как при обычном копировании теряется чёткость линий и читаемость подписей. Для них есть специальные приёмы:

Способы экспорта диаграмм:

  • 📊 Сохранение как объекта:
    1. Кликните правой кнопкой по диаграмме → Сохранить как рисунок.
    2. Выберите формат EMF (векторный) или PNG (растровый).
  • 🖼️ Копирование через буфер:
    1. Выделите диаграмму и нажмите Ctrl+C.
    2. Вставьте в PowerPoint или Word → кликните правой кнопкой → Сохранить как рисунок.
  • 🌐 Экспорт в SVG (для веб):
    1. Скопируйте диаграмму в Inkscape (бесплатный векторный редактор).
    2. Сохраните как SVG для масштабирования без потерь.

    Рекомендации для диаграмм:

    • 🎨 Для печати выбирайте EMF или PDF — они сохраняют векторное качество.
    • 📏 Увеличьте размер шрифтов подписей до 12–14 pt перед экспортом.
    • 🔍 Избегайте gradients (градиентов) в заливке — они плохо сжимаются в JPEG.
    • 7. Конвертация на Mac (Numbers и Preview)

      Пользователи macOS могут столкнуться с трудностями при работе с Excel, но в экосистеме Apple есть альтернативные решения. Например, Numbers (аналог Excel) и встроенное приложение Preview для постобработки.

      Пошаговая инструкция для Mac:

      1. Откройте файл .xlsx в Numbers (автоматически конвертируется).
      2. Выделите таблицу и выберите Файл → Экспорт в → PDF.
      3. Откройте полученный PDF в Preview.
      4. Используйте Файл → Экспорт и выберите формат PNG/JPEG с разрешением 300 dpi.

    Особенности работы на Mac:

    • 🍎 Numbers лучше сохраняет прозрачность при экспорте в PNG.
    • 🖱️ В Preview можно обрезать изображение перед сохранением (Инструменты → Обрезка).
    • ⚠️ Некоторые шрифты Excel (например, Calibri) могут отображаться иначе в Numbers.

    Сравнение методов: какой выбрать?

    Метод Качество Скорость Сложность Лучше для
    Копировать как картинку ⭐⭐ ⭐⭐⭐⭐⭐ Быстрых скриншотов
    PDF → изображение ⭐⭐⭐⭐ ⭐⭐⭐ ⭐⭐ Печатных материалов
    Онлайн-сервисы ⭐⭐⭐ ⭐⭐⭐⭐ Разовых задач
    Плагины (Kutools) ⭐⭐⭐⭐ ⭐⭐⭐⭐ ⭐⭐⭐ Регулярного экспорта
    VBA-скрипты ⭐⭐⭐⭐ ⭐⭐⭐⭐⭐ ⭐⭐⭐⭐ Автоматизации

    Выбор метода зависит от ваших приоритетов:

    • 🏆 Максимальное качествоPDF → изображение или плагины.
    • СкоростьКопировать как картинку или онлайн-сервисы.
    • 🤖 АвтоматизацияVBA-скрипты.
    • 📱 Мобильные устройства → онлайн-конвертеры.
    • FAQ: Частые вопросы

      Можно ли конвертировать Excel в картинку без потери качества?

      Да, если использовать промежуточный экспорт в PDF с разрешением 300 dpi, а затем конвертировать PDF в изображение через Adobe Acrobat или Foxit Reader. Также подойдут плагины вроде Kutools, которые позволяют задавать высокое разрешение при сохранении.

      Почему при копировании таблицы в Paint получается размытое изображение?

      Причина в низком разрешении буфера обмена (обычно 96 dpi). Чтобы улучшить качество:

      1. Увеличьте масштаб отображения в Excel до 200–400% перед копированием.
      2. Используйте PDF как промежуточный формат.
      3. Вставляйте не в Paint, а в Photoshop или GIMP — они лучше обрабатывают векторные данные.
      Как экспортировать только видимую область таблицы (без скрытых строк)?

      Скрытые строки/столбцы по умолчанию тоже попадают в картинку. Чтобы экспортировать только видимые данные:

      1. Выделите диапазон и нажмите Alt+; (это выделит только видимые ячейки).
      2. Используйте Копировать как картинку или плагин Kutools с опцией Export visible cells only.

      Для VBA добавьте в скрипт строку: ws.UsedRange.SpecialCells(xlCellTypeVisible).CopyPicture.

      Какие форматы изображений лучше подходят для таблиц?

      Выбор формата зависит от цели:

      • PNG — для веб и документов (поддерживает прозрачность, сжатие без потерь).
      • JPEG — для фотографий и графиков (меньший размер, но артефакты при сжатии).
      • TIFF — для полиграфии (высокое качество, большой вес).
      • SVG — для веб-дизайна (векторный формат, масштабируемый).

      Для большинства задач оптимален PNG-24.

      Можно ли автоматизировать экспорт сотен таблиц в изображения?

      Да, для этого подойдут:

      • VBA-скрипты — напишите макрос, который перебирает все листы книги и сохраняет их как PNG.
      • ПлагиныKutools или Ablebits поддерживают пакетную обработку.
      • Python-скрипты — с использованием библиотек openpyxl и Pillow (для продвинутых пользователей).

      Пример VBA для пакетного экспорта:

      Sub ExportAllSheetsAsImages()
      

      Dim ws As Worksheet

      Dim exportPath As String

      For Each ws In ThisWorkbook.Worksheets

      ws.UsedRange.CopyPicture Appearance:=xlScreen, Format:=xlPicture

      exportPath = "C:\Temp\" & ws.Name & ".png"

      ' Здесь код для сохранения картинки (аналогично примеру выше)

      Next ws

      End Sub